Why do soups and teas go bad and unsafe to drink if left out in room temperature for a few hours but it’s perfectly safe to drink a glass of water left out overnight?

Wouldn’t bacteria also grow in the water left out and release toxins?

Soups and teas have organic compounds added to them that are much more nourishing for microorganisms.

Water’s just water. If you leave it out long enough, it’ll become unsafe to drink, but that’s because you have to wait for enough dust etc. to fall inside it for there to be something to kick off an environment where a self-sustaining biome can happen.

Think about being trapped in a grocery store for a week vs. being trapped in a water treatment facility. Being surrounded by all that water won’t do you much good if there’s no food!
